Recap: 6 Journaling Ideas

  • Write down your goals every day.
  • Keep a daily log.
  • Journal three things you’re grateful for every day.
  • Journal your problems.
  • Journal your stresses.
  • Journal your answer to “What’s the best thing that happened today?” every night before bed.

Is there a difference between a journal and a diary?

A diary is a book to record events as they happen. A journal is a book used to explore ideas that take shape.

What is the difference between a bullet journal and a diary?

A diary is mainly used to write things you would like to remember – daily activities, how the day was spent, what was done, the daily routine and anything that needs to get done. For a journal, one does not just record one’s experiences but also thoughts, feelings and reflections.

What should I put in my bullet Journal?

If you want to liven up your bullet journal, or you’re just not sure what you could include, here are some ideas:

  1. Your yearly resolutions.
  2. Your monthly goals.
  3. A goal tracker.
  4. A habit tracker.
  5. A spending log.
  6. A books read list.
  7. A books to read list.
  8. A page illustrated with things that make you happy.

How do I start bullet Journal for beginners?

Bullet Journaling for Beginners: 8 Steps to Get Started

  1. Step 1: Adjust Your Mindset.
  2. Step 2: Get a Journal and Writing Utensils.
  3. Step 3: Start an Index Page.
  4. Step 4: Create Logs.
  5. Step 5: Pick Signifiers.
  6. Step 6: Document Items with Collections.
  7. Step 7: Make Time for It.
  8. Step 8: Get Better, Gradually.
